Witch's Castle | Oregon Photo Spot
Share this Page
Witch’s Castle, nestled within Macleay Park in Portland, Oregon, USA, is a fascinating photography destination steeped in local history and legend. Constructed in the mid-1930s by the Works Progress Administration (WPA), this stone structure once served as a public restroom until 1962. Today, the enchanting ruins of the Witch’s Castle provide a captivating backdrop for photographers as they explore the area where the Wildwood Trail meets the Lower Macleay Trail along Balch Creek. Venture into the heart of Portland’s lush forest to uncover the hidden gem of the Witch’s Castle and capture the intriguing charm of this historic structure.
(Portland, Oregon, USA)